Portman Clarity unveils new brand

Thursday, 08 May, 2017 0

Portman Clarity, the UK’s eighth largest TMC, has dropped the 58-year-old Portman brand name and will be known from today only as Clarity.

CEO Pat McDonagh said the decision had been taken following an indepth review into the brand strengths of both businesses following their merger in November.

Research included canvassing the opinion of 500 industry colleagues, 100 of whom were invited to workshops, after which the company decided on ‘a fusion’ of the two brands.

From now on, the company will be known as Clarity but it has kept the Portman strapline ‘The Business Travel Experts’ and some of its colours have been incorporated into the new brand.

Also, the name of the parent company has been changed from Mawasem Travel and Tourism to Portman Travel Group.

The new brand was unveiled to the company’s employees over the weekend and it will be rolled out across the group from today.
